57 Sherborne Road, Wolverhampton, WV10 9EU is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 915 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£158,036 , which equates to approximately £173 per square foot. It was last sold on 13 Apr 2017 for £98,000. Since then, the value has increased by £60,036, representing a 61.3% increase, or approximately 6.7% per year.

The current estimated value of £158,036 is:

  • 0.6% lower than the average property price on Sherborne Road
  • 5.3% lower than the average in the WV10 9EU postcode area
  • and 43.1% lower than the average price for Wolverhampton as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 16 August 2016,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

57 Sherborne Road, Wolverhampton, West Midlands, WV10 9EU has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 9 May 2018.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 16 Aug 2016, and the property received the same rating of D with an unchanged energy efficiency score of 56.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The wall energy efficiency improving from very poor to poor, with the construction or insulation remaining sol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ed).
  • The windows were upgraded from partial double gl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 70%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
